I would agree with this, in general. Someone on their way to a very high level isn't going to get stuck or plateau at a mid-level for long. 550 is "just passing through" on the way up.Someone who will become a 700 level willl be a 550 for about 2 months. You either have the genetics for it or you don't.
The exception is that some players get involved in Fargo quite young and have a huge number of games in the system, then as they mature and get better, the number is slow to move. Case in point is Savannah Easton, who plays beyond her 660 range (she beat several men that were well over 700 in a recent tournament, not to mention many such women), but she has thousands and thousands of games in, so it looks like she is stuck at a rating when the tournamant results show otherwise.
